In Openfoam for LES I know that you can implement a function in the controlDict file which calculates average velocity at each point based on all the time steps. If this is not implemented before the simulations begins, is there a way to do this now the simulation has finished ? FoamCalc perhaps? regards Ollie |

Check this thread
http://www.cfd-online.com/Forums/ope...rocessing.html The only problem I found with this postaverage utility is it only uses the time data you saved, opposed to the fieldaverage function in run time that uses all timestep data. |
